Aircraft Description
N5664N is a Maule MX-7-235, a single-engine reciprocating (piston) aircraft registered to Three Bees Farms INC in Keysville, GA. The registration certificate was issued on August 28, 2023. The registration is set to expire on August 31, 2030. The aircraft is configured with 5 seats. The aircraft's Mode S transponder code is A74025 (hex), used for ADS-B identification and flight tracking. N5664N was last tracked by AviatorDB at coordinates 31.0849, -83.8033 on April 8, 2025. Maule Air, based in Moultrie, Georgia, manufactures rugged utility aircraft designed for short-field and bush operations. Maule aircraft are popular in backcountry flying, aerial photography, and utility work. AviatorDB tracks 1,499 Maule aircraft currently registered in the FAA database, including the MX-7-235 model.
